A woman who impos food from Mexico and spends several months per year in rural Mexico had to have a compound leg fracture pinned and set in Mexico and has returned 3 days later. She now has signs of acute appendicitis and is taken to surgery in Houston. When her appendix is removed, it is found to contain a light-colored, 20.5-cm long roundworm and bile-stained knobby eggs consistent with Ascaris. How did she acquire this infection?

A
Ingestion of water containing filariform larvae
B
Skin penetration by filariform larvae
C
Skin penetration by rhabditiform larvae
D
Ingestion of food contaminated with the eggs
